Physical Description[edit]
Construct dolls are humanoid dolls that vary in both size and in shape. They can have any modification imaginable, such as wings, extra arms, or extra legs. Their body is made up of a combination of steel and variously colored fabric. The design of a construct doll is only limited by the imagination, with some holding more functionality than others. They are sustained through magic that was inserted into their bodies by the magic user who made them.
History[edit]
Construct dolls are constructs created by powerful artificers or wizards that are created for a multitude of purposes. Some are used merely as assistants and others are used as guardians or protectors. Whatever the purpose a construct doll serves, they often hold little sentience and are likely doomed to a life of servitude.
Society[edit]
Construct dolls are a servant race and thus their society is that of servitude towards their creators. Rarely does a construct doll break free of the servitude, but it is not unheard of. An independent construct doll comes to be either from breaking free from their servitude, or the death of their creator. Such construct dolls often spend their lives wandering, with no real purpose, and are often rejected by society.

Construct Doll Traits[edit]
Construct dolls are powerful, humanoid creations that vary in size and shape depending on function and imagination.
Ability Score Increase. Any ability score of your choice other than Constitution increases by 1 and your Constitution increases by 2.
Age. As a construct, you are created fully mature and you do not age.
Alignment. You are very often lawful, but otherwise tend to follow your creator's alignment. Alone, you are often lawful neutral.
Size. Construct Dolls vary in size, ranging from 4 ft to 8 ft, and your size ranges from small to medium.
Speed. Your base walking speed is 30 feet.
Inserted Mechanism. You have a weapon with the light property or tool/kit inside of you that you can insert or remove as a bonus action. You gain proficiency in the tool/kit or weapon with the light property that you choose.
Thick Exterior. Your AC equals 11 + your constitution modifier when you are wearing no armor.
Special Engineering. You gain one of the following:
Impenetrable Mind. You gain resistance to Psychic damage.
Unliving Body. You have resistance to Poison damage.
Inexhaustible. You are considered to have one less level of exhaustion than you actually do.
Predictable Lawfulness. When you have disadvantage, you can choose to roll without disadvantage. This feature is useable once per short or long rest
Construct Nature. You do not have to breathe, eat, drink, or sleep. When you take a long rest, you must spend at least six hours in an inactive, motionless state, rather than sleeping. In this state, you appear inert, but it doesn’t render you unconscious, and you can see and hear as normal.
Languages. You can speak, read, and write Common and one other language of your choice.

Suggested Characteristics[edit]
When creating a Construct Doll character, you can use the following table of traits, ideals, bonds and flaws to help flesh out your character. Use these tables in addition to or in place of your background's characteristics.
d8 | Personality Trait |
---|---|
1 | I don't understand the motivations of others around me. |
2 | I have to remain perfectly orderly, even when I am in a dangerous situation. |
3 | I feel at ease when alone. |
4 | I believe that I can be accepted into the community, even if I am different. |
5 | I feel more intelligent and powerful than anyone else I have met. |
6 | I am the pinnacle of my kind, and no natural creation shall surpass me. |
7 | When people treat my like a slave or oddity, I do not believe that they should. |
8 | My craft is the only thing that really matters to me. |
d6 | Ideal |
---|---|
1 | Power. The people around me are weak, and the only creatures worthy to walk the earth are constructs. (Evil) |
2 | Logic. I must use my greater comprehension of the world to my advantage. (Lawful) |
3 | Serenity. When I am separated from the rest of the world, I can finally unleash my potential. (Neutral) |
4 | Respect. All beings deserve to be treated like equals, even if they are constructs. (Good) |
5 | Community. A functioning community is like a machine, all of its parts must work together in harmony. (Lawful) |
6 | Self-Improvement.I must make myself the most powerful of my kind, and I will not let others stop me. (Any) |
d6 | Bond |
---|---|
1 | I must defend my creator to my last breath. He/she gave me life, so I must preserve theirs. |
2 | My people are just as kind-hearted as others, and I will do anything to prove it. |
3 | I lived as a slave, and now that I am free I will do anything to prevent this happening to others. |
4 | My enslavement sets boundaries, and i can use these boundaries to my advantage. |
5 | I was attacked because I was different, and I will fight back against those who do that. |
6 | The tools of my craft are all I have, and I will put them to good use. |
d6 | Flaw |
---|---|
1 | I hate myself for my man-forged form, and envy the natural beings who are so real. |
2 | I overlook obvious solutions in place of more complicated ones. |
3 | I secretly believe that everyone is beneath me. |
4 | I was but a worker, and I did not have enough time to train myself mentally. |
5 | I say what I think, and sometimes what I think insults others. |
6 | I do not understand the workings of by body, and this leads to my huge self-doubt. |
